科普干貨 | 物聯網架構和技術協議
2021年10月22日 10:19 瀏覽:2127
隨著科技的不斷發展,特別是5G的誕生,物聯網的數量和覆蓋范圍的擴大,都給物聯網技術帶來前所未有的挑戰,但是由于物聯網技術協議的可用性和擴展性,推動并支持了大部分新技術的增長。所以,今天就帶大家深入了解一下物聯網架構和技術協議。
從更高層次來看,物聯網是一個異構網絡,由云計算層負責檢索和處理從其他層獲取的信息。
圖 2-1 是一個物聯網生態系統的簡單示意圖。從圖中可以看到,物聯網相關數據可以存儲在物聯網網絡中的多個位置。物聯網網絡和基于云的系統中的傳感器、網關和本地設備可以存儲不同數量的數據。
中間的云計算層在生態系統中占據著重要地位,可以存儲大量信息,并基于這些數據做出決策;它可以有效集成來自解決方案各組件的數據。將云添加到物聯網還可以提高安全性、可用性、可擴展性和性能,因為云存儲/數據庫提供商愿意采用這些功能,以幫助他們在相關行業領域取得成功。
由于云也有缺點,比如通信延遲。此外,有時云會不可用,或者需要更快的處理周轉時間。
在這些情況下,邊緣計算誕生了。當數據在傳感器或網關的源端處理和存儲時,就會發生邊緣計算,而且只有在需要額外處理時,網絡才會使用云。有些終端設備并不總是將數據發送回云,而是使用邊緣計算在源端存儲和處理數據。這有助于為最終用戶提供更實時的體驗,也有助于確保網絡安全。
在功率或帶寬受到限制時,邊緣計算尤其有用。使用傳感器在網絡邊緣對數據流實施有用處理可以降低功耗,并更有效地使用帶寬。邊緣計算不會將可識別身份的信息發送至云,而是在源端存儲和處理,這有助于保護用戶的隱私。隨著物聯網技術不斷發展,延遲逐漸成為更大的問題,邊緣計算將變得更加普及,以實現實時處理。
一些物聯網應用已經成熟,比如無線控制家用恒溫器或使用手機打開車門。但未來,物聯網的潛在應用將更加廣泛,規模也更大。這些未來應用將需要能夠在后臺進行大量數據傳輸和處理的物聯網架構平臺。
這種物聯網平臺/架構由幾個內部連接層組成(參見圖 1-1)。
我們來詳細了解一下物聯網平臺各連接層中的各個組件:
傳感器和執行器:物聯網傳感器和執行器用于測量溫度、聲音、濕度和振動等。
物聯網網關:
網關在本地網絡和英特網之間傳送數據。首
云基物聯網平臺:通過網關傳輸的數據存儲在云基物聯網平臺或公司的數據中心,并在那里進行處理。然后,可利用這些數據執行智能操作和制定決策。
應用:最后,物聯網設備的數據可用于各種應用,以幫助人們或組織做出更明智的決定或采取具體措施。這些應用可將云端信息推送至智能手機、平板電腦或計算機上的應用。應用層對用戶來說最重要,因為它是用戶與物聯網網絡的接口,允許用戶控制和監控物聯網系統的許多要素,有時還可以實現實時控制和監控。
通信協議構成物聯網系統的主干,可將物聯網設備連接至網絡,并最終連接至應用和用戶。通過定義數據交換格式、數據編碼、設備尋址方案以及數據包從節點到目的地的路由方式,這些基于標準的專有協議使數據能夠在物聯網架構的不同層之間傳輸。
物聯網生態系統包括一系列支持短程、本地和廣域網的不同協議,且所有這些協議都可以共存。每種技術在范圍、傳感和控制以及傳輸不同類型信息的能力方面都具有特定的特性。這些技術組合在一起可實現所有無線范圍和功能的無縫覆蓋。例如:藍牙非常適用于短程應用,而窄帶物聯網 (NB-IoT) 則非常適用于遠程應用。
IEEE 802.15.4 標準是低速率無線個人局域網 (LR-WPAN) 標準的集合。這些標準可為功率受限設備提供低成本、低速通信。它們構成了高級通信協議(如 ZigBee)規范的基礎。ZigBee 是一種專為低功耗運行而設計的網狀網絡,可用于智能家居和公用設施的智能能源應用。ZigBee 基于 IEEE 802.15.4 物理層 (PHY) 和介質訪問控制 (MAC) 標準。
Wi-Fi 是 IEEE 802.11 無線局域網 (WLAN) 通信標準的集合。它可為室內和室外場所提供較高的傳輸速率,且應用非常廣泛。
藍牙是由 Bluetooth Special Interest Group (SIG) 維護的開放標準。它是一種低成本的無線通信技術,適用于移動設備之間的短距離(如 8 - 10米)數據傳輸。它可用于音頻流媒體、汽車、揚聲器和耳機等應用。
藍牙低功耗 (BLE)是藍牙標準的組成部分, 專為低功耗運行而設計。BLE 設備通常使用紐扣電池工作,可用于物聯網設備,如燈泡和照明開關。
Thread 是一種低功耗、基于互聯網的安全網狀網絡技術,適用于物聯網產品。2014 年成立了 Thread Group 工作小組,旨在推動 Thread 的普及。
Thread 可實現安全的低功耗網狀網絡,支持現有的基于 IPv6 的連接標準。
LoRa 是一種由 LoRa 聯盟開發的低功耗廣域網 (LPWAN) 協議,適用于遠程通信。該技術是大規模農業應用傳感器的最佳之選。
蜂窩標準(如 5G)可為物聯網服務提供網絡主干,同時支持高數據速率和遠程通信。NB-IoT 是一種常用的蜂窩物聯網標準,可用于智能停車、公用設施管理和制造自動化。
這些消息傳遞協議用于設備之間以及與云端之間的數據共享。物聯網協議是物聯網技術堆棧的關鍵組成部分,如果沒有它們,硬件根本無法工作。利用物聯網協議,物聯網設備能夠以一種受控和有意義的方式交換數據。
看了以上介紹,是不是可以根據物聯網部署的獨特情況來確定哪種協議最合適自己的項目了。想了解更多技術內容,請點擊
閱讀原文
。
技術鄰APP
工程師必備